After years of responding to Eldridge proper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Eldridge property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Storm damage often shows up first as a small ceiling stain in Eldridge properties, but by the time it's visible, water has usually already reached the insulation and framing underneath.
Clogged municipal lines, tree root intrusion, and sump pump failures can send contaminated water back into Eldridge basements and lower levels, requiring specialized cleanup and sanitizing.
A slowly failing water heater in a Eldridge home can leak for weeks before it's discovered, often causing more structural damage than a sudden pipe burst would.
Improper grading around a Eldridge property's foundation can direct rainwater toward the structure instead of away from it, leading to chronic basement or crawlspace moisture over time.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Eldridge property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

Plenty of Eldridge homeowners try to handle a small water event themselves before calling us. Here's what usually gets missed.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Eldridge hom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
Insurance carriers generally want to see documented proof that a water loss was properly mitigated. A DIY cleanup rarely produces that kind of record, which can leave Eldridge homeowners exposed if related damage — like mold or warped subfloor — shows up months later and the carrier questions whether it was handled correctly the first time.
If the water was minor, contained, and cleaned up within an hour or two, DIY handling is often fine. Once it's soaked into materials or sat for any real length of time, though, a professional assessment is the safer move for your Eldridge property.
Every water loss is different, but these general safety steps apply to most Eldridge calls we receive.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
If water is anywhere near electrical panels or outlets in your Eldridge property, stay away and avoid that area entirely.
If it's safe, move furniture, electronics, and important documents away from the affected area or up off the floor.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
